32:1 reduction in a 160 mm planetary frame

The GBX1600321083D is a Schneider Electric planetary gearbox from the GBX series with a 32:1 reduction ratio, an 800 N·m continuous output torque rating, and a 160 mm gearbox external diameter — built around straight-cut gearing in a black anodized aluminium housing with a C 45 steel output shaft. Maximum output torque is 1280 N·m, so the gearbox carries roughly 1.6× its continuous figure in peak demand — useful for sizing acceleration cycles on a servo-driven axis without derating the reducer to its continuous ceiling.

Torque envelope and shaft loading

Continuous output torque sits at 800 N·m with a 1280 N·m maximum — the peak/continuous ratio is the figure to budget for cyclic shock loads such as indexing or start/stop duty on a conveyor or pick-and-place axis. Maximum radial force Fr is 4200 N at 100 rpm applied at mid-distance from the output shaft over a 30000 hour life at 30 °C, rising to 6000 N if the duty is capped at 10000 hours; maximum axial force Fa is 6000 N at the 30000-hour rating, 8000 N at the 10000-hour rating. At a 30 °C ambient and 100 rpm, the rated service life is 30000 hours — the gearbox is lubricated for life, so no relube interval is on the nameplate; sizing the application below the continuous torque ceiling is what protects that envelope.

Precision, noise, and the operating envelope

Maximum torsional backlash is 10 arc.min and torsional rigidity is 41 N·m/arcmin — adequate for general motion control and positioning where sub-arcminute backlash is not required, but a stop to consider on high-precision indexing axes. Moment of inertia is 6.36 g.cm² at the input, so the gearbox adds minimal reflected inertia to the motor — a small figure that keeps servo loop tuning tractable when paired with a typical servo drive. Noise level is 70 dB at 1 m under no-load, shaft output sealing is IP54, and the operating ambient range is -25 to 90 °C — sealed enough for an enclosure-mounted reducer, but not rated for washdown or outdoor exposure. Efficiency is 94 %, the reflection loss between input and output at the 32:1 ratio — typical for a single-stage planetary with straight teeth, and the figure to fold into motor torque sizing.
